Capcom has released two gameplay trailers for Tokyo Game Show which have a focus on moves that Spencer can perform with his bionic arm in the upcoming Bionic Commando ReArmed 2. A couple of them, such as a circular whip motion and ground pound, will probably be familiar to those who played the 3D Bionic Commando from last year.

A really useful move is shown quite a bit in the second video below. Spencer can apparently just plow barrels out of the way with his robo-fist instead of having to pick them up and throw them if they're in his path. It's really cool. The only thing I'll warn you about is that this second trailer has one of the most painful re-interpretations of the Bionic Commando theme I've ever heard. Headache-inducing, even.
